> > > I am using MS SQL2000, this is what I did.
> > >
> > > <persistenceAdapter>
> > > <journaledJDBC journalLogFiles="5"
> > > dataDirectory="../activemq-data" dataSource="#mssql-ds">
> > > <adapter><imageBasedJDBCAdaptor/></adapter>
> > > </journaledJDBC>
> > > </persistenceAdapter>
> > >
> > >
> > > <bean id="mssql-ds" class="org.apache.commons.dbcp.BasicDataSource"
> > > destroy-method="close">
> > > <property name="driverClassName"
> > > value="com.microsoft.jdbc.sqlserver.SQLServerDriver"/>
> > > <property name="url" value="jdbc:microsoft:sqlserver://HOSTNAME
> > > \\INSTANCE;DataBaseName=DBNAME"/>
> > > <property name="username" value="sa"/>
> > > <property name="password" value="password"/>
> > > </bean>
> > >
> > > And it works.

> > > Does anyone have an example using Microsoft Sql Server for persistence?
> > >
> > >
> > >
> > > I have the following configuration:
> > >
> > >
> > >
> > > <persistenceAdapter>
> > >
> > > <journaledJDBC journalLogFiles="5"
> > > dataDirectory="../activemq-data" dataSource="#mssql-ds"
> > > useJournal="false">
> > >
> > > <statements>
> > >
> > > <statements binaryDataType="varbinary(max)"/>
> > >
> > > </statements>
> > >
> > > </journaledJDBC>
> > >
> > > </persistenceAdapter>
> > >
> > >
> > >
> > > And
> > >
> > >
> > >
> > > <!-- Microsoft Sql Server DataSource -->
> > >
> > > <bean id="mssql-ds"
> > > class="com.microsoft.sqlserver.jdbc.SQLServerConnectionPoolDataSource">
> > >
> > > <property name="URL" value="jdbc:sqlserver://localhost:1433"/>
> > >
> > > <property name="databaseName" value="BUZMessaging"/>
> > >
> > > <property name="integratedSecurity" value="true"/>
> > >
> > > </bean>
> > >
> > >
> > >
> > > When ActiveMQ starts the following warning appears:
> > >
> > >
> > >
> > > WARN JDBCPersistenceAdapter - Database driver NOT recognized:
> > > [microsof
> > >
> > > t_sql_server_2005_jdbc_driver]. Will use default JDBC implementation.
> > >
> > >
> > >
> > > Does this mean that the Sql Server 2005 JDBC Driver is even being used?
> > >
> > >
> > >
> > > If not how do I configure the mssql-ds bean?
